How to Make Garlic Butter Chicken with Zucchini and Corn – One-Pan, 30-Minute Meal

Now that you have your ingredients ready, let’s dive into the cooking process! This Garlic Butter Chicken with Zucchini and Corn – One-Pan, 30-Minute Meal is simple and straightforward. Follow these steps, and you’ll have a delicious dinner on the table in no time!

Step 1: Heat the Garlic Butter

Start by heating the garlic butter in a large skillet over medium heat. This temperature is key for even cooking. You want the butter to melt and bubble gently, releasing that wonderful garlic aroma. It sets the stage for the chicken to soak up all that flavor!

Step 2: Season the Chicken

While the butter is heating, season your chicken breasts with salt, pepper, and Italian seasoning. This step is crucial for flavor! The seasoning enhances the chicken, making it juicy and delicious. Don’t be shy—make sure every inch is coated for maximum taste!

Step 3: Cook the Chicken

Once the butter is hot, add the seasoned chicken to the skillet. Cook for about 5-7 minutes on each side until golden brown and cooked through. To check for doneness, cut into the thickest part; it should be white and juices should run clear. Perfectly cooked chicken is the heart of this dish!

Step 4: Sauté the Vegetables

After removing the chicken, add the sliced zucchini and corn to the skillet. Sauté for about 3-4 minutes until they’re tender but still crisp. This quick cooking time keeps the veggies vibrant and fresh, adding a lovely crunch to your meal!

Step 5: Combine and Garnish

Return the chicken to the skillet, mixing it with the sautéed vegetables. This allows the flavors to meld beautifully. Before serving, garnish with fresh parsley for a pop of color and a hint of freshness. Your Garlic Butter Chicken with Zucchini and Corn is now ready to impress!

Tips for Success

  • Always use a meat thermometer to ensure chicken reaches 165°F for safety.
  • Prep your ingredients ahead of time to streamline the cooking process.
  • Don’t overcrowd the skillet; cook in batches if necessary for even browning.
  • Feel free to customize the veggies based on what you have on hand.
  • Let the chicken rest for a few minutes before slicing for juicier meat.

FAQs about Garlic Butter Chicken with Zucchini and Corn – One-Pan, 30-Minute Meal

Can I use frozen chicken breasts for this recipe?

Yes, you can use frozen chicken breasts! Just make sure to thaw them completely before cooking. This ensures even cooking and helps avoid any rubbery texture.

What can I substitute for zucchini?

If zucchini isn’t your favorite, you can easily substitute it with bell peppers, asparagus, or even broccoli. Each option brings its own unique flavor and texture to the dish!

How do I store leftovers?

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. Reheat in the microwave or on the stovetop for a quick meal later!

Can I make this dish ahead of time?

While this Garlic Butter Chicken with Zucchini and Corn is best enjoyed fresh, you can prep the ingredients ahead of time. Chop the veggies and season the chicken, then cook when you’re ready!

Is this recipe gluten-free?

Absolutely! This Garlic Butter Chicken with Zucchini and Corn – One-Pan, 30-Minute Meal is naturally gluten-free, making it a great option for those with dietary restrictions.

Description

A quick and easy one-pan meal featuring tender chicken cooked in garlic butter, paired with fresh zucchini and sweet corn.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 4 tablespoons garlic butter
  • 2 medium zucchinis, sliced
  • 1 cup corn (fresh or frozen)
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
  • Fresh parsley for garnish

Instructions

  1. Heat garlic butter in a large skillet over medium heat.
  2. Season chicken breasts with salt, pepper, and Italian seasoning.
  3. Add chicken to the skillet and cook for 5-7 minutes on each side until golden brown and cooked through.
  4. Remove chicken from the skillet and set aside.
  5. Add zucchini and corn to the skillet, sautéing for 3-4 minutes until tender.
  6. Return chicken to the skillet, mixing with the vegetables.
  7. Garnish with fresh parsley before serving.

Notes

  • For a spicier kick, add red pepper flakes.
  • Can substitute chicken with shrimp or tofu for a different protein option.
  • Serve with rice or quinoa for a complete meal.
